While debugging locations I noticed the semi_embedded_vec template
in line-map.h doesn't declare a copy ctor or copy assignment, but
is being copied in a couple of places in the C++ parser (via
gcc_rich_location).  It gets away with it most likely because it
never grows beyond the embedded buffer.

Where are these places?  I wasn't aware of this.

They're in the attached file along with the diff to reproduce
the errors.

Thanks.

Looks like:

    gcc_rich_location richloc = tok->location;

is implicitly constructing a gcc_rich_location, then copying it to
richloc.  This should instead be simply:

    gcc_rich_location richloc (tok->location);

which directly constructs the richloc in place, as I understand it.

I see, tok->location is location_t here, and the gcc_rich_location
ctor that takes it is not declared explicit (that would prevent
the implicit conversion).

The attached patch solves the rich_location problem by a) making
the ctor explicit, b) disabling the rich_location copy ctor, c)
changing the parser to use direct initialization.  (I CC Jason
as a heads up on the C++ FE bits.)
